Summary
The Lead Engineer, Software develops, debugs, tests, deploys and supports code to be deployed in systems/products/equipment for various applications.
They write, debug, maintain, and test software in various common languages and for software at various levels in the hierarchy (from Firmware to Application).
Software creation follows an agreed to development process (such as Agile, Scrum, etc.) and complies with the product life cycle development (phase/gate deliverables).
The Lead Engineer, Software works in cross functional teams with other designers, customers, manufacturing engineering and project leadership to ensure robust and high quality product development.
Detailed Description
Performs tasks such as, but not limited to, the following:
Work as a team member who understands/interprets technical problems and provides technical support.
Solve assigned problems under guidance of more senior engineers.
Analyze, design and develop tests and test-automation suites.
Design and develop a processing platform using various configuration management technologies.
Test software development methodology (may be done in agile environment)
Provide ongoing maintenance, support and enhancements in existing systems and platforms.
Collaborate cross-functionally with customers, users, project managers and other engineers including Peer-Reviews to achieve elegant solutions.
Provide recommendations for continuous improvement.
Work alongside other engineers on the team to elevate technology and consistently apply best practices.
Keep up to date with relevant industry knowledge and regulations
